Lacoda's Obituary

Lacoda Jefferson, 92, formerly of St. Joseph, went to meet her Lord & Savior, Monday, July 19, 2004, at River Ridge Retirement Village in South Haven where she resided. A Celebration of Life Service will be held at 3:00 P.M. Thursday at Kerley-Starks & Menchinger Family Funeral Home, 2650 Niles Rd., St. Joseph with Rev. Jon Bendewald officiating. Burial will follow at Riverview Cemetery, St. Joseph. Friends may call one hour prior to the service at the funeral home. Memorials may be made to Trinity Lutheran Church, St. Joseph or St. Joseph-Lincoln Senior Center. Those wishing to share a memory or sign the guest book online may do so at www.starks-menchinger.com. Lacoda was born January 7, 1912 in Benton Harbor to Leopold & Olga (Schlender) Nusbeitel. She worked as a waitress at Berrien Hills Country Club & Holly?s Landing; and most recently as a clerk at the Amtrak Station at the Depot in St. Joseph. Lacoda was a member of Trinity Lutheran Church and the St. Joseph-Lincoln Senior Center. She enjoyed tending to her flower & vegetable gardens and her lawn. Lacoda truly had a green thumb, there was nothing that she couldn?t grow. Lacoda is survived by three brothers-Ewald (Ruth) Nusbeitel of E. Tawwas, MI; Paul (Virginia) Nusbeitel of Spring Lake, FL; Arnold (Jerry) Nusbeitel of Stevensville; three sisters-Marie Tillman of Lawrence, MI; Frieda Fleener of Waterford, MI; Antoinette Stevenson of Tigert, OR; and many nieces & nephews. Lacoda was preceded in death by her parents, a sister Lena Gallagher; a brother Irving Nusbeitel, and her long time canine companion Snowflake.
